The Spider (Al-Ankaboot)
In the Name of Allah, the Merciful, the Most Merciful
۞ AlifLaamMeem. 1 Do people think that they will be left alone because they say: "We believe," and will not be tested. 2 Yea, indeed, We did test those who lived before them; and so, [too, shall be tested the people now living: and] most certainly will God mark out those who prove themselves true, and most certainly will He mark out those who are lying. 3 Or do they who commit evil deeds imagine that they can escape from Us? What an evil judgement they impose! 4 Whoso looks to encounter God, God's term is coming; He is the All-hearing, the All-knowing. 5 And whoever strives in Allah's cause, strives only for his own benefit; indeed Allah is Independent of the entire creation. 6 Those who believe and do good deeds, We shall cleanse them of their evil deeds and reward them according to the best of their deeds. 7 We have enjoined man to show kindness to his parents. But if they bid you associate with Me something about which you have no knowledge, do not obey them. To Me you shall all return, and I shall tell you about all that you have done. 8 We shall surely admit those who believe and do good deeds to the company of the righteous. 9 Then there are among men such as say, "We believe in Allah"; but when they suffer affliction in (the cause of) Allah, they treat men's oppression as if it were the Wrath of Allah! And if help comes (to thee) from thy Lord, they are sure to say, "We have (always) been with you!" Does not Allah know best all that is in the hearts of all creation? 10 And Allah most certainly knows those who believe, and as certainly those who are Hypocrites. 11 Those who deny the truth say to the faithful, "Follow our way, and we will bear the burden of your sins." But they will bear none of their sins. They are surely lying. 12 They shall certainly carry their loads, and other loads besides their loads, and on the Day of Resurrection, they shall be questioned about what they forged. 13
